Marshall George Cummings Jr., born on October 10, 1950, in Claremore, Oklahoma, passed away on Wednesday, October 30, 2024, in Pryor, Oklahoma, at the age of 73.
Marshall was a devoted husband to Pamela Cummings, with whom he shared a loving home. His legacy continues through his sons, Anthony Cummings and Carl Cummings, as well as his stepsons, Anthony McClelland and Jason Edwards, and his stepdaughter, Teria Hoover. As a proud grandfather, he cherished the time spent with his five grandchildren.
No services are planned at this time. To leave a personal message, please visit his guest book at www.shipmansfuneralhome.com. Arrangements are under the direction of Shipman's Funeral & Cremation Service of Pryor.
